Foros del Web

Foros del Web (http://www.forosdelweb.com/)
-   .NET (http://www.forosdelweb.com/f29/)
-   -   VB 2005 & Crystal Reports (http://www.forosdelweb.com/f29/vb-2005-crystal-reports-531679/)

jetzona 08/11/2007 13:43

VB 2005 & Crystal Reports
 
hola, tengo una duda con unos reportes que estoy realizando, paso a explicar la situación, en estos momentos estoy imprimiendo un reporte en cristal reports es un boleto de viaje en bus, lo hago de la siguiente forma:
creo un reporte en CR luego creo la cantidad de Parameter Fields que necesite y luego desde el código instancio un nuevo objeto del tipo del reporte

EJ: Public rpt As New Boleto

donde rpt es el objeto de tipo Boleto que es el nombre del reporte
luego en el código de visual asigno valores a los Parameter Fields del reporte de la siguiente manera

EJ: rpt.SetParameterValue("origen", ori)

luego imprimo el boleto con la instrucción

EJ: rpt.PrintToPrinter(1, True, 1, 1)

Todo esto funciona ok, pero ahora deseo imprimir los datos de una CONSULTA SQL

EJ: select Asiento, Destino, Valor desde la tabla "Ejemplo" donde la el N° planilla es = 99999999

y eso me deberia imprimir algo asi:

N° planilla: 99999999
Asiento Destino Valor
1 Concepcion $10000
2 Concepcion $10000
3 Concepcion $10000
4 Concepcion $10000
12 Chillan $7500
13 Concepcion $10000
21 Concepcion $10000
22 Concepcion $10000

en si aqui se imprimen los asientos vendidos correspondientes a una planilla de pasajeros

como puedo hacer esto?
aaaa para realizar mis conexiones a BD lo hago a trabes de una conexión general y voy creando datasets para trabajar con los datos en los distintos formularios

jetzona 09/11/2007 06:35

Re: VB 2005 & Crystal Reports
 
Hey , please alguien debe saber la respuesta ,no creo que sea tan dificil pero yo no lo he podido concretar:'( :'( :'(

help me please!!!

jetzona 12/11/2007 08:31

Re: VB 2005 & Crystal Reports
 
Gracias...

jetzona 13/11/2007 10:27

Re: VB 2005 & Crystal Reports
 
habiendo encontrado la soluciones bastante sencilla
se le pasa el data set al reporte y listo, obviamente previo a esto tienes que insertar en el reporte los campos a mostrar

para pasar 1 parámetro
Plani.SetParameterValue("patente", PatenteTextBox.Text)

para pasar un consulta

primero la consulta
Me.Det_planillaTableAdapter.FillByPlanilla(Me.Deta llePlanillaDS.Det_planilla, 18)

luego se lo pasamos al reporte
Plani.SetDataSource(Me.DetallePlanillaDS)

y eso es todo


super facil
si necesitan detalles no duden en consultar

MANIFIESTO
compartir información nos hace bien a todos
esconderla o no explicar bien no ayuda y denota egoísmo

dany2718 19/02/2008 09:21

Re: VB 2005 & Crystal Reports
 
Hola amigos, tengo una duda parecida a la de ustedes, mi programa se trata de llevar las reparaciones realizadas a las computadoras, ahora bien lo que quiero es cuando recibo una pc entregarle al cliente una constancia de que me dejo la maquina especificando su nombre direccion fecha, reparacion y observaciones,etc etc yo tengo un formulario en el cual lleno esos datos algunos son etiquetas otros son textbox, como puedo hacer para pasarle al reporte los datos del formularios?? no entiendo muuuucho de programacion me las rebusco pero esto me esta sobrepasando cuento con su ayudar y desde ya muchas gracias....

pd: programo en vb 2005 express y Visual Estudio 2005

moar82 05/02/2009 17:43

Respuesta: Re: VB 2005 & Crystal Reports
 
Cita:

Iniciado por jetzona (Mensaje 2185485)
habiendo encontrado la soluciones bastante sencilla
se le pasa el data set al reporte y listo, obviamente previo a esto tienes que insertar en el reporte los campos a mostrar

para pasar 1 parámetro
Plani.SetParameterValue("patente", PatenteTextBox.Text)

para pasar un consulta

primero la consulta
Me.Det_planillaTableAdapter.FillByPlanilla(Me.Deta llePlanillaDS.Det_planilla, 18)

luego se lo pasamos al reporte
Plani.SetDataSource(Me.DetallePlanillaDS)

y eso es todo


super facil
si necesitan detalles no duden en consultar

MANIFIESTO
compartir información nos hace bien a todos
esconderla o no explicar bien no ayuda y denota egoísmo


Hola Jetzona, me gustaria saber si me puedes explicar esta información, ya que yo también he estado buscando como mandar un consulta con parametros al crystal reports y no he encontrado información. Al igual que tu, tengo una consulta para un usuario particular con un ID que se escribe en un textbox y con eso hago una consulta. Quiero que esa consulta se vaya a un reporte pero no sé como funciona, si tengo que crear un procedimiento almacenado o algo asi.
podrias ayudarme? Sólo explicame tu código, los nombres de los controles o el codigo referente a esa parte.

TE lo agradeceria mucho,
Saludos,

Rod.


La zona horaria es GMT -6. Ahora son las 18:51.

Desarrollado por vBulletin® Versión 3.8.7
Derechos de Autor ©2000 - 2026, Jelsoft Enterprises Ltd.